How do I connect my Acer to a monitor?
Plug one end of the HDMI cable into your computer’s HDMI port and the other end into the Acer Monitor’s HDMI port. The HDMI port on your desktop computer is located on the back of the tower near the DVI or VGA connections of your video card. On a laptop, the HDMI port is typically located on the side of the laptop.

How do you change the input source on an Acer monitor?
How do I switch between the VGA and DVI input signals on my…
- On the lower bezel of your monitor, press the MENU button to enter the onscreen menu.
- Use the arrow buttons to navigate to the icon and press the MENU button to enter the submenu.
- Select the input signal and press the MENU button to confirm.
Why does monitor say input not supported?
The error “Input not supported” occurs when the computer’s resolution doesn’t match with the monitor. This error usually comes forward when you plug in a new monitor with your computer or you change the resolution to some value which is not supported.

How do I use the HDMI port on my Acer?
- Turn off your TV, monitor or projector before making the connection.
- Plug the HDMI cable into the “HDMI” port on the side of your laptop.
- Plug the other end of the cable into the “HDMI IN” port on the display.
